Following up on the concept of using laser pointers to help teach NPOA and the FRANKEN14s that I have available, there was discussion about using laser targets. Well, I just received from Midway a couple of the Laserlyte reaction tyme targets which are currently on sale (http://www.midwayusa.com/product/159951/laserlyte-lts-reaction-tyme-target-system). There are two targets per set. I did get one of their .223 laser inserts for actual trigger work but have found that these targets will work with a standard green laser pointer. The only thing that I want to pursue with these is if I can make a mask to fit over the target to approximate the black area of an AQT at approx. 20' (sized down appropriately of course).
